Investing.com - Park City Group reported on Monday first quarter earnings that missed analysts' forecasts and revenue that fell short of expectations.
Park City Group announced earnings per share of $0.060 on revenue of $4.72M. Analysts polled by Investing.com anticipated EPS of $0.080 on revenue of $5.36M.
Park City Group shares are down 63% from the beginning of the year and are trading at $5.030 , down-from-52-week-high.
